NME relaunch
In the last week the print edition and online editions of the NME have had a bit of a facelift and a relaunch.

The print edition doesn't look too bad, with clearer news and reciews sections, but I'm pretty sure it's only 6 months since the last rebranding.

The online edition, NME.com, appears to be harder to use than the old site. The news page is now hard to read and obscured by adverts; the pictures take forever to load; there's still no RSS feed and as far as I can see there is no way to access an archive of articles that have appeared in the print edition. V poor indeed.
